An officer with the Franklin Township (NJ) Police Department who reportedly overdosed on heroin while on duty in April has been fired.

According to the Bridgewater Courier News, former officer Matthey Ellery pleaded guilty to possession of heroin and driving while intoxicated, and has now been fired by his agency.

Ellery pleaded guilty as part of a plea agreement in which he will apply for admission into a five-year drug treatment program, with an alternative sentence in the range of three to five years in New Jersey State Prison if he fails to successfully complete the drug program.
